Professors Joseph Sorensen and Nobuko Koyama, along with 25 current, former, and future JCHIP interns hosted three visiting Japanese children's home directors. Professors Koyama and Sorensen conducted a thorough business meeting concerning the current structure and future of JCHIP, and showed them some “Western” hospitality with big steaks at Cattlemen’s. A couple of returnees joined them on a campus tour the following day.
